Trump, Silver & Critical Minerals: What’s Next for Mining? | John Feneck

In this interview, John Feneck, CEO of Feneck Consulting, provides an insightful analysis of precious metals and critical minerals markets.

Feneck begins by addressing Trump’s potential tariffs on Canada and their implications for the mining sector. He then shares specific price predictions, expressing a particularly bullish outlook for silver with a target of $50 within 12-18 months.

The discussion includes analysis of several undervalued opportunities in the junior mining sector, with Feneck highlighting companies like First Nordic, Golden Caribou, and NexGold. 

Feneck also offers perspective on the critical minerals competition between the US and China, providing context for investors interested in this strategic sector.
